There might have been an accidental assignment to group two. What I would do is save all of your cues (or at least write them down), and clear all groups, and start recording over. Press: Setup--> more (soft key) -->Clear-->2-->1 to confirm. If this doesn't work, there may be a memory corruption. In this case, save all board memory to a 3.5'' floppy. Then reset the board by turning it off, then back on while holding the "clear" key. Reload your memory (with cues, if you saved them) and continue regularly. I hope everything works out okay.
